```tsx
|
||||
// packages/app/scaffolder/MyCustomExtension/index.ts
|
||||
|
||||
/*
|
||||
This is where the magic happens and creates the custom field extension.
|
||||
|
||||
Note that if you're writing extensions part of a separate plugin,
|
||||
then please use `plugin.provide` from there instead and export it part of your `plugin.ts` rather than re-using the `scaffolder.plugin`.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
|
||||
import {
|
||||
plugin,
|
||||
createScaffolderFieldExtension,
|
||||
} from '@backstage/plugin-scaffolder';
|
||||
import { MyCustomExtension } from './MyCustomExtension';
|
||||
import { myCustomValidation } from './validation';
|
||||
|
||||
export const MyCustomFieldExtension = plugin.provide(
|
||||
createScaffolderFieldExtension({
|
||||
name: 'MyCustomExtension',
|
||||
component: MyCustomExtension,
|
||||
validation: myCustomValidation,
|
||||
}),
|
||||
);
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Once all these files are in place, you then need to provide your custom
|
||||
extension to the `scaffolder` plugin.
|
||||
|
||||
You do this in `packages/app/App.tsx`. You need to provide the
|
||||
`customFieldExtensions` as children to the `ScaffolderPage`.
|
||||
|
||||
```tsx
|
||||
const routes = (
|
||||
<FlatRoutes>
|
||||
...
|
||||
<Route path="/create" element={<ScaffolderPage />} />
|
||||
...
|
||||
</FlatRoutes>
|
||||
);
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Should look something like this instead:
|
||||
|
||||
```tsx
|
||||
import { MyCustomFieldExtension } from './scafffolder/MyCustomExtension';
|
||||
const routes = (
|
||||
<FlatRoutes>
|
||||
...
|
||||
<Route path="/create" element={<ScaffolderPage />}>
|
||||
<ScaffolderFieldExtensions>
|
||||
<MyCustomFieldExtension />
|
||||
</ScaffolderFieldExtensions>
|
||||
</Route>
|
||||
...
|
||||
</FlatRoutes>
|
||||
);
|
||||
```

## Using the Custom Field Extension
|
||||
|
||||
Once it's been passed to the `ScaffolderPage` you should now be able to use the
|
||||
`ui:field` property in your templates to point it to the name of the
|
||||
`customFieldExtension` that you registered.
|
||||
|
||||
Something like this:
|
||||
|
||||
```yaml
|
||||
apiVersion: backstage.io/v1beta2
|
||||
kind: Template
|
||||
metadata:
|
||||
name: Test template
|
||||
title: Test template with custom extension
|
||||
description: Test template
|
||||
spec:
|
||||
parameters:
|
||||
- title: Fill in some steps
|
||||
required:
|
||||
- name
|
||||
properties:
|
||||
name:
|
||||
title: Name
|
||||
type: string
|
||||
description: My custom name for the component
|
||||
ui:field: MyCustomExtension
|
||||
```
